Deal between Chiefs, Eric Berry not ruled out yet, per reports

While there were reports on Wednesday that Eric Berry and the Kansas City Chiefs are unlikely to reach a deal before Friday’s deadline, more reports are emerging on Thursday that a deal hasn’t been ruled out yet.

This according to reports from NFL Network’s Ian Rapoport and the KC Star’s Terez Paylor.

I probably shouldn’t speculate on sources but yesterday’s reports a deal wasn’t likely to happen sure seemed like it came from Berry’s camp while these reports today sure seem like they’re coming from the Chiefs. I can’t say for sure though.

The key point here is the one Rapoport makes — Dorsey’s best offer comes on Friday. Chiefs fans know that because we’ve been paying attention over the years, including last season with Justin Houston. Berry’s camp probably realizes that as well so they’re waiting to see the best offer.

Hopefully, they’re waiting to see the last offer and quickly accept it. Despite all the reports, doing a deal now benefits both Berry and the Chiefs.
